Weight Capacity Limits

Choosing the right trap bar for deadlifts requires careful attention to its weight capacity, which can vary greatly between models. Most trap bars have loadable sleeves, allowing you to customize the weight, with capacities typically ranging from 400 lbs to over 1000 lbs. For advanced lifters or those aiming to lift heavier, a higher capacity bar is vital to guarantee safety and durability. The bar’s material and construction play a significant role; solid steel designs generally support greater loads. It’s important to match the bar’s weight capacity to your lifting goals and experience level to prevent overloading and potential injury. Always check manufacturer specifications to confirm the maximum load, making sure your training remains safe and effective.

Handle Ergonomics and Grip

The design of the handles on a trap bar plays a crucial role in how comfortably and efficiently you can lift, especially during heavy deadlifts. Handles with knurled textures provide a more secure grip, reducing slipping and hand fatigue. Ergonomically raised handles can help ease lower back strain by promoting a natural lifting posture and decreasing the distance you need to lift. A wider grip space accommodates different hand sizes and offers multiple grip options, increasing workout versatility. The height and angle of the handles influence muscle engagement and can make lifts feel more comfortable or more challenging. Proper handle design minimizes fatigue and enhances stability, allowing for better performance and safer, more effective lifts over time.

Bar Length Compatibility

The length of a trap bar plays a key role in your deadlift performance by affecting your range of motion and overall lifting experience. Most bars are around 50 to 60 inches long, which strikes a balance between stability and ease of use. A longer bar provides a wider stance and more space for movement, but it can also be less maneuverable in smaller gyms. Compatibility with standard Olympic weight plates is essential, as most trap bars use 2-inch sleeves. Sleeve length varies from 9 to 16 inches, allowing for different loading options, so consider how much weight you plan to add. Additionally, the overall width impacts grip options and stability, so choose a size that fits your space and lifting style for peak performance.

Durability and Material

Since durability is essential for safe and effective deadlifts, focusing on the material quality of a trap bar is important. Solid steel is a top choice because it offers excellent sturdiness and longevity, which are critical for heavy lifting. I also recommend looking for bars with protective coatings like black powder or electrophoretic finishes; these help resist rust and corrosion, extending the bar’s lifespan. The weight of the bar can indicate its robustness, with heavier models generally providing better stability. Equally important is a high maximum weight capacity—ideally supporting at least 400 lbs—to guarantee safety during intense lifts. Additionally, reinforced welds and quality control measures contribute considerably to durability, making sure the bar can withstand rigorous use over time without compromise.
